The Demon Lords Chapter 111

The four surrendered tribes, including the Nadu Department, were located to the east, south, west, and north of the oasis. The Nadu Department itself was in the northern part, at the foot of Yin Mountain. A century of strategic suppression by the Earl of North Border had been so effective that even his ’puppet’ allied barbarian troops had developed a confident air. Especially in the last twenty years, the other barbarian tribes had rarely launched any counterattacks against the Earl of North Border, leading the Nadu Department’s people to become complacent.

Naduo Jiayang, the "Junior Chief" of the Nadu Department, had assigned fewer than a thousand of his personal guards to a pasture within their territory. He hadn’t publicized this, so the tribe’s perimeter security remained as lax as ever.

The mounted scouts sent out at night would, by habit, find a sheltered spot out of the wind. Wrapped in sheepskin cloaks, they would take a few swigs of mare’s milk wine and soon be dreaming of the Barbarian God.

So, when nearly twenty thousand troops from the other three surrendered tribes had already approached the outskirts of the Nadu Department, there was still no reaction from within.

What happened next was not surprising.

All of them removed the bits from their horses’ mouths, unwrapped the cloth from their hooves, and raised their sabers.

The three tribal chiefs stood at the forefront. They exchanged glances. They each knew that after tonight, only three of the four surrendered tribes would remain.

It was impossible for them not to feel a sense of shared sorrow, for their tribes were connected to the Nadu Department by marriage. But they had no choice. Beyond the Nadu encampment, the iron cavalry of the Earl of North Border watched like tigers ready to pounce, and the Old Madam herself was personally overseeing the battle. The three chiefs had no path of retreat.

The three tribal chiefs raised their sabers in unison and swung them down.

Thousands of horses surged forward, and the warriors of the three tribes let out excited, piercing howls.

They weren’t burdened with the same complex thoughts as their chieftains; all they knew was that tonight, everything belonging to the Nadu Department would be theirs!

It was just a shame the chiefs had specifically ordered no captives. A real pity, they thought, the Nadu Department had quite a few fine women.

The galloping of the warhorses sounded like rolling thunder, jolting the entire Nadu Department awake.

Their defenses were lax, but this didn’t mean they lacked brave and skilled warriors. Many, upon waking, instantly realized what was happening: their tribe was under attack for the first time in nearly twenty years.

Some snatched up their blades, others rushed to their warhorses, demonstrating excellent training. But this readiness proved inconsequential in the face of the surprise raid from the three other tribes.

Just then, Nado Anli, an elder of the Nadu Department, rushed into the tribal chief’s tent, only to be stunned by what he saw. Despite the thunderous commotion outside, the chief was still fast asleep on his couch. Beside the couch, a woman cowered, trembling violently. Clearly, she too sensed the calamity unfolding outside.

Looking at the soundly sleeping chief, then at the woman—the Junior Chief’s new concubine—Great Elder Nado Anli’s lips twisted into a smile. It was a desolate laugh. He knew. The Nadu Department... was finished. Utterly finished.

The Nadu Department’s palisades and barracks were no match for a cavalry charge. Soon, riders from the three attacking tribes poured into the camp from three directions.

For a hundred years, as the hunting dogs of the Earl of North Border, they had repeatedly preyed upon their own kin. Now, they turned on each other, engaging in mutual slaughter!

With the kill-on-sight order in effect, every living member of the Nadu Department became their prey; not one was to be spared.

This wasn’t annexation, nor a dispute over pastures. This was... extermination!

A single word from the Old Madam, and tonight, a tribe of tens of thousands would be wiped from existence.

The desert winds would blow away all traces of their existence.

The cries of children, the screams of women, and the roars of men became the night’s brutal symphony.

Already caught by a surprise night attack and without their chief’s command, the Nadu Department was as fragile as paper. Any pockets of resistance hastily formed after the initial assault were quickly annihilated by the surging tide of the three tribes’ cavalry.

"Junior Chief, they’re attacking! They’re attacking!"

A blood-soaked warrior from the Nadu Department rushed to Naduo Jiayang, collapsing at his feet and crying out.

People were dying, everywhere. The members of the Nadu Department were being ruthlessly cut down, their numbers dwindling rapidly...

"Who is it? Who attacked us?" Naduo Jiayang roared, grabbing the warrior sprawled before him.

He was in an open area to the south of the main tribal settlement, so he hadn’t been hit by the initial cavalry assault. However, he could already see the glow of fires from the tribe’s central gathering place and hear screams so agonizing they felt like his own heart was being gouged out.

"It’s the Amo Tribe, the Guren Tribe, and the Cai Tribe! They’re the ones attacking us!"

"How is this possible? How could this happen? How dare they! How dare they! Aren’t they afraid of retribution from the Earl of North Border?"

This Junior Chief, this supposed descendant of the Barbarian God, actually uttered such a question at a time .

"Impossible, impossible, impossible..."

Naduo Jiayang had completely lost his composure. His nearly thousand loyal warriors gathered around him. Some clamored to charge back, drive out the invaders, and avenge their kin. Others were more rational; they understood the situation was beyond saving. Their priority was to break out with the Junior Chief before the enemy cavalry reached them, to preserve a flicker of hope for the Nadu Department’s survival.
